An approximate Spikey can be constructed from an icosidodecahedron by augmentation with tetrahedra on the triangular faces and removing pentagonal pyramids on the pentagonal faces. The dihedral angle between adjacent equilateral triangles—one from a tetrahedron and the other from an adjacent pyramid—differs from 180° by less than 1°.

Details

A "Giramundo" [1, 2] can be made using 60° rhombuses or golden rhombuses.
